</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-1 hover-type-none"><img fetchpriority="high" decoding="async" width="1800" height="1200" title="n"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/n.png"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-15721"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/n-200x133.png 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/n-400x267.png 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/n-600x400.png 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/n-800x533.png 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/n-1200x800.png 1200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/10/n.png 1800w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-2 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h3 data-start="212" data-end="268">Elevated Safety Standards: What the Gold Award Means</h3>
<p data-start="269" data-end="716">Euro NCAP’s shaken things up with its updated 2025 standards for light vans, and grabbing a Gold rating under these new rules is no mean feat. They’re not just looking at how a van handles a crash anymore—they also want to know how good it is at avoiding one in the first place. That means testing things like autonomous emergency braking (AEB), how well it looks out for cyclists and pedestrians, and what driver assistance kit it has on board.</p>
<p data-start="718" data-end="1123">The Townstar stood out thanks to its decent across-the-board results. It’s got a smart AEB system that uses both radar and cameras to help spot hazards, and in tests it did a solid job avoiding crashes. Euro NCAP gave it a near-perfect 14.5 out of 15 for speed assistance and 26.8 out of 30 for pedestrian and cyclist protection—figures that put it ahead of quite a few rivals in the same class.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-3 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h3 data-start="1130" data-end="1171">Advanced Tech for Safer Urban Driving</h3>
<p data-start="1172" data-end="1454">You’re getting a lot of safety features with the Townstar—over 20, they say—including handy bits like Blind Spot Warning, Intelligent Emergency Braking, ProPILOT (a form of clever cruise control), lane assist, hands-free parking, and even a 360-degree camera view.</p>
<p data-start="1456" data-end="1609">For a van, that’s pretty impressive. A lot of these gizmos are normally found on cars, not commercial vehicles, especially ones at this kind of budget.</p>
<p data-start="1611" data-end="1882">What’s more, all this tech has been put through its paces under Euro NCAP’s newer, tougher 2025 rules. Those are based more on how vans actually get used in real life—think delivery work and jobs in busy towns and cities—so you know these features aren’t just for show.</p>
<h3 data-start="1889" data-end="1937"></h3>
<h3 data-start="1889" data-end="1937">UK-Spec Townstar EV: Practical and Efficient</h3>
<p data-start="1938" data-end="2293">The Nissan Townstar EV, which took over from the old e-NV200 in March 2023, is built with city driving in mind. With its 45 kWh battery, it’s got enough juice to officially go up to 183 miles on the WLTP cycle. And if you&#8217;re mostly sticking to slow city routes, you could see as much as 269 miles—more than enough to last a full workday.</p>
<p data-start="2295" data-end="2543">When the battery runs low, charging options are flexible. It supports 11kW and 22kW AC charging, and thanks to 80kW DC rapid charging, you can top it up from 15 to 80% in about 37 minutes. Ideal if you’re grabbing lunch between stops.</p>
<p data-start="2545" data-end="2745">Despite being electric, the practical stuff hasn’t taken a hit. You can haul up to 800 kg, fit in 3.3 to 4.3 cubic metres of stuff, and even tow up to 1,500 kg, so it still does the job.</p>

</div></div><div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-5 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-6 fusion_builder_column_2_3 2_3 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:66.666666666667%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:3.84%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:2.88%;--awb-width-medium:66.666666666667%;--awb-order-medium:0;--awb-spacing-right-medium:3.84%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:2.88%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-order-small:0;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-column-has-shadow f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-7 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2><strong>What is it?</strong></h2>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-8 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>The 2025 Nissan Interstar-e is Nissan’s big electric van for the UK, landing right when businesses are hunting for greener ways to move stuff around. It’s aimed at fleets and tradespeople who want to get into a zero-emissions setup, especially with more low-emission zones popping up and fuel prices being what they are. With a solid payload and some handy battery choices, it’s got what it takes to stand up against the Citroën ë-Relay, Renault Master E-Tech, and Ford E-Transit.</p>
<p>It’ll be hitting the roads sometime in 2025, and there are two battery options. The long-range 87kWh version is the one most UK drivers will be looking at. Add that to the mix of sizes and roof options, and you’ve got a van that can be tailored to all sorts of jobs</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-5 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1200" height="642" title="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_007"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_007.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-14036"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_007-200x107.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_007-400x214.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_007-600x321.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_007-800x428.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_007.jpg 1200w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-9 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Exterior Design</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-10 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>From the outside, the Interstar-e does a good job of looking like a proper modern workhorse. Nissan’s sharpened up the old design a bit—more aerodynamic now, which they reckon cuts drag by 20% compared to the last one. That should help it go a bit further on a charge and makes it nicer to drive on the motorway.</p>
<p>It’s very function-first, with clean, simple looks. The rear and side doors open up nice and wide, and you can pick between L2/L3 lengths and H2/H3 roof heights. Depending on the version, you&#8217;re looking at load space between 10.8m³ and 14.8m³—plenty for most jobs</p>
<h3></h3>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-6 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1200" height="800" title="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_042"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_042.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-14037"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_042-200x133.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_042-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_042-600x400.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_042-800x533.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_042.jpg 1200w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-11 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2 data-pm-slice="1 1 &#091;&#093;">Performance &amp; Range</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-12 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>You’ve got two choices here. The bigger 87kWh battery comes with a 105kW (143bhp) motor that pulls 300Nm of torque. On paper, that’s good for up to 285 miles on the WLTP test cycle, and it can charge fast too—130kW DC charging means you can get around 157 miles back in just half an hour. If your depot’s got a 22kW AC charger, you can go from 10 to 100% in under four hours</p>
<p>Then there’s the 40kWh version, which drops to 96kW (129bhp) with the same torque. Official WLTP range is between 112–124 miles, and DC charging tops out at 50kW, so it’s clearly more for short city hops.</p>
<p>Nissan haven’t said what the exact efficiency figures are, but between the improved shape and pretty decent regenerative braking, it handles itself well even with a load on. If you’re doing a mix of city and A-road driving in the 87kWh version, you’ll likely see somewhere between 220–250 miles, cargo included</p>
<h3></h3>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-7 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1200" height="800" title="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_049"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_049.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-14038"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_049-200x133.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_049-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_049-600x400.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_049-800x533.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_049.jpg 1200w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-13 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2 data-pm-slice="1 1 &#091;&#093;">Comfort &amp; Interior Features</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-14 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>Inside, it’s still very much a working van but done right. Feels a bit like a small lorry cab in here, which is a good thing—everything’s laid out neatly, there’s loads of space, and the driving position’s spot on. Every version gets a 10-inch centre touchscreen and a 7-inch digital display in front of the driver. You’ll also get smartphone mirroring and a built-in sat nav, so all the basics are sorted.</p>
<p>You’ve got up to 20 driver assist systems to back you up too—for things like emergency braking or keeping things in check if you’re pulling a trailer. Safety-wise, it’s top marks: Euro NCAP gave it their best ‘Platinum’ rating. So you&#8217;ve got stuff like intelligent speed assist and stability control keeping everything in line.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-8 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1200" height="800" title="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_113"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_113.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-14041"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_113-200x133.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_113-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_113-600x400.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_113-800x533.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_113.jpg 1200w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-15 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Practicality</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-16 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>This is where the Interstar-e really pulls its weight. The 4.0-tonne 87kWh model can carry up to 1,625kg—pretty impressive for something electric. Even the smaller 40kWh version can haul up to 1,125kg in its 3.5t form. Both can tow up to 2,500kg as well.</p>
<p>Depending on the spec you go for, you can fit up to 14.8m³ of stuff in the back, with combinations of L2/L3 lengths and H2/H3 roofs on offer. When you factor in the strong range and quick charging, it’s easy to see how this could handle proper day-in, day-out work without needing endless charging stops.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-9 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1200" height="800" title="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_108"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_108.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-14040"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_108-200x133.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_108-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_108-600x400.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_108-800x533.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2025/06/Nissan_Interstar_PK_Final_High_108.jpg 1200w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-17 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2><strong>Verdict</strong></h2>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-18 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>Prices start at £32,390 (before VAT) for the basic version and go up to about £41,250 for the higher trims in the 4.0t range, like the Acenta and Tekna. With a 5-year/100,000-mile vehicle warranty and 8 years on the battery, Nissan’s backing this van for the long game.</p>
<p>Against its closest rivals—the Renault Master E-Tech (which shares the same battery), the Citroën ë-Relay with its shorter 154-mile range, and Ford’s E-Transit that offers 196 miles with some flashy SYNC tech—the Interstar-e manages to tick a lot of practical boxes: solid range, strong payload, and speedy charging.</p>
<p>If you’re running a fleet or need a reliable electric van that can put in a full shift without fuss, the Interstar-e makes a lot of sense. It’s not fancy, and it’s not revolutionary, but it gets the job done with minimal drama—and sometimes, that’s exactly what you want</p>

</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:30px;--awb-margin-bottom:30px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-13 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="2478" height="1372" title="Screenshot 2024-03-25 at 10.02.20"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Screenshot-2024-03-25-at-10.02.20.png"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-8991"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Screenshot-2024-03-25-at-10.02.20-200x111.png 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Screenshot-2024-03-25-at-10.02.20-400x221.png 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Screenshot-2024-03-25-at-10.02.20-600x332.png 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Screenshot-2024-03-25-at-10.02.20-800x443.png 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Screenshot-2024-03-25-at-10.02.20-1200x664.png 1200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/03/Screenshot-2024-03-25-at-10.02.20.png 2478w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div style="text-align:center;"><a class="fusion-button button-flat button-xlarge button-default fusion-button-default button-4 fusion-button-default-span fusion-button-default-type"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;" target="_self" href="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/van/mercedes-benz/model-sprinter/"><span class="fusion-button-text awb-button__text awb-button__text--default">Explore the Mercedes Sprinter</span></a></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-25 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-margin-top:30px;--awb-margin-bottom:30px;"><h2>Nissan Interstar</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-26 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:30px;--awb-margin-bottom:30px;"><p>Previously known under the NV400 moniker, the Nissan Interstar has been updated to meet the diverse needs of the modern business. Offering a range of four trim levels and various cargo volumes (from 8 to 17 cubic meters), the Interstar is designed to accommodate businesses of all sizes. For those concerned with load capacity, the L1H1 model impressively supports a 1600kg payload, making it suitable for heavy and bulky goods.</p>
<p>One of the standout features of the Nissan Interstar is its generous 5-year warranty, showcasing Nissan&#8217;s confidence in the durability and reliability of this model. This commitment could provide significant peace of mind for business owners, ensuring that their vehicle is covered against unexpected repairs and maintenance issues.</p>
<p>The Interstar also offers practicality and comfort within its cabin, designed to make long drives more bearable for drivers and passengers alike.</p>

</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-39 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Engine options and Specifications</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-22 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1788" height="1178" title="Screenshot 2024-01-31 at 11.35.06"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.35.06.png"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-7672"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.35.06-200x132.png 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.35.06-400x264.png 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.35.06-600x395.png 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.35.06-800x527.png 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.35.06-1200x791.png 1200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.35.06.png 1788w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-40 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>The Nissan Interstar offers a comprehensive range of engine options and specifications, tailored to cater to various business requirements. At the core of its performance are the dCi diesel engines, known for their balance of power and efficiency. Here’s a detailed look at what the Interstar brings under its hood and its accompanying specifications:</p>
<h3>Engine Options</h3>
<p><strong>dCi Engines</strong>: The Interstar&#8217;s engine lineup is centered around the dCi diesel engines, providing a spectrum of power outputs from 110HP to 180HP. This range allows businesses to choose the engine that best fits their operational needs and driving conditions.</p>
<h3>Power Variants:</h3>
<p><strong>Front-Wheel Drive (FWD) Options</strong>: These include engines with outputs of 110HP, 135HP, 150HP, and 180HP. The diversity in horsepower options caters to varying demands of load capacity and driving dynamics.</p>
<p><strong>Rear-Wheel Drive (RWD) Options</strong>: For those requiring more robust power, the rear-wheel-drive models come with 145HP and 165HP engines. These are particularly suited for heavier loads and more demanding tasks.</p>
<p><strong>Emission Compliance</strong>: All engines in the Interstar range are Euro 6D compliant, ensuring they meet the latest emission standards. This compliance is crucial for businesses looking to reduce their environmental footprint and adhere to urban emission regulations.</p>
<h3>Transmission and Drive Options</h3>
<p><strong>Six-Speed Manual Transmission</strong>: Standard across the range, this transmission is designed for a smooth and responsive driving experience, providing precise control over the vehicle.</p>
<p><strong>Semi-Automatic Gearbox</strong>: Available as an option, this gearbox offers convenience and ease, especially in urban driving conditions or during long journeys where driver fatigue might be a concern.</p>
<p><strong>Drive Options</strong>: The choice between front-wheel and rear-wheel drive allows businesses to select a van that best matches their driving conditions and load distribution needs.</p>
<h3>Trim Levels and Specifications</h3>
<p><strong>Visia</strong>: The entry-level trim comes equipped with essential features like a 110HP engine in front-wheel drive, an adjustable driver’s seat, and a basic but functional interior setup. It’s a no-frills, straightforward package designed for practicality.</p>
<p><strong>Acenta</strong>: This mid-range trim level adds more options in terms of power, size, and comfort. It includes features like rear parking sensors, cruise control, and lumbar support for the driver’s seat. It strikes a balance between functionality and comfort.</p>
<p><strong>Tekna</strong>: Moving up the range, Tekna introduces enhanced features like automatic wipers and headlights, front parking sensors, and a rearview camera. It&#8217;s designed for those who spend significant time on the road and appreciate added convenience.</p>
<p><strong>Tekna+</strong>: The top-tier trim encompasses advanced safety systems like lane departure warning and blind spot detection. It represents the pinnacle of what the Interstar has to offer, combining power, luxury, and safety.</p>

</div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-43 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2><strong>Loading capacity and Practicality</strong></h2>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-24 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="2070" height="1174" title="Screenshot 2024-01-31 at 11.34.45"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.34.45.png"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-7670"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.34.45-200x113.png 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.34.45-400x227.png 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.34.45-600x340.png 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.34.45-800x454.png 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.34.45-1200x681.png 1200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/Screenshot-2024-01-31-at-11.34.45.png 2070w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-44 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-top:20px;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>The Nissan Interstar is designed with a strong focus on practicality, offering a range of dimensions and load capacities to suit various business needs. This section delves into the specifics of its practical features, dimensions, and its capacity to handle different cargo types.</p>
<h3>Practicality</h3>
<p>The Interstar is engineered for convenience and efficiency in commercial settings. Its design includes features that enhance its usability in a range of work environments:</p>
<p><strong>Easy Access:</strong> The van features wide-opening rear doors and sliding side doors, allowing for effortless loading and unloading of goods. This design is particularly beneficial in tight urban spaces or busy loading docks.</p>
<p><strong>Robust Chassis</strong>: Built on a sturdy chassis, the Interstar can be adapted for various commercial uses, including conversions into a Dropside, Tipper, or Box van, making it highly versatile.</p>
<p><strong>Driver Comfort:</strong> With an emphasis on reducing driver fatigue, the Interstar’s cabin is designed for comfort during long drives, featuring adjustable seats and modern ergonomic layouts.</p>
<h3>Dimensions</h3>
<p>The Interstar&#8217;s dimensions are tailored to offer a variety of options, catering to different volume and space requirements:</p>
<p><strong>Length Options (L1-L4)</strong>: The van is available in four lengths, providing flexibility for different cargo sizes. The longest version (L4) is particularly suited for transporting lengthy materials.</p>
<p><strong>Height Options (H1-H3)</strong>: With three height options, the Interstar can accommodate taller cargo items, enhancing its usability for a range of business applications.</p>
<p><strong>Customizable Configurations</strong>: The combination of different lengths and heights means businesses can select a van that precisely fits their space requirements.</p>
<h3>Load Capacity</h3>
<p>The load capacity of the Nissan Interstar is a key aspect of its practicality:</p>
<p><strong>Maximum Cargo Volume</strong>: The van offers a generous maximum cargo volume of up to 17m³, particularly in the rear-wheel-drive configurations. This space is ample for large deliveries or equipment.</p>
<p><strong>Carrying Capacity</strong>: The Interstar is capable of handling heavy-duty tasks, with a payload capacity of up to 1,587kg. This makes it suitable for transporting heavy goods or equipment.</p>
<p><strong>Interior Space Utilization</strong>: The cargo area is thoughtfully designed to maximize space utilization. Its square-shaped interior and minimal wheel arch intrusion allow for efficient packing and storage of goods.</p>
<p><strong>Length of Cargo Area</strong>: The boot space or cargo area can accommodate items up to 4.4m in length, which is beneficial for trades that require transportation of long materials like pipes or timber.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-12 fusion-flex-container hund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="width:104% !important;max-width:104% !important;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-19 fusion_builder_column_1_1 1_1 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:100%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:2.56%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:1.92%;--awb-width-medium:100%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:2.56%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:1.92%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-title title fusion-title-15 fusion-sep-none fusion-title-text fusion-title-size-one" style="--awb-margin-top-small:10px;--awb-margin-right-small:0px;--awb-margin-bottom-small:10px;--awb-margin-left-small:0px;"><h1 class="fusion-title-heading title-heading-left fusion-responsive-typography-calculated" style="margin:0;--fontSize:40;line-height:1.2;">Nissan</h1></div></div></div></div></div><div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-13 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-20 fusion_builder_column_2_3 2_3 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:66.666666666667%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:3.84%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:2.88%;--awb-width-medium:66.666666666667%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:3.84%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:2.88%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-33 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="748" height="445" title="eNV200Front-748&#215;445"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200Front-748x445-1.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-5824"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200Front-748x445-1-200x119.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200Front-748x445-1-400x238.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200Front-748x445-1-600x357.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200Front-748x445-1.jpg 748w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 748px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-62 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>The Nissan e-NV200 has been the backbone of the Nissan Commercial Vehicle electric van offering for over 10 years, indeed it’s probably safe to say its been the best selling electric van in the UK over that time. Initially the diesel version outsold the e-NV200 well until the last three or four years but sales of the electric version were so strong in the latter years they decided for the last couple of years, only the electric version would be available, therefore dropping the 1.5 diesel variant. Nissan have recently announced the replacement of the e-NV200 but there are still many in dealer stocks So what are the key dimensions of this stalwart of the alternative fuel sector.</p>
<h2>Overall Dimensions</h2>
<p>The e-NV200 is an interesting van, in that, the vehicle sits in between the small and medium van sector but has a much smaller ‘footprint’ than many of them. Keeping it simple there is only one van model based on a 2725mm wheelbase which results in an overall length of 4560mm and the width without the mirrors is 1755mm, finally the overall height when unladen is 1755mm.</p>
<h2>Cargo Area</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-34 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1089" height="663" title="eNV200LoadArea"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200LoadArea.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-5825"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200LoadArea-200x122.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200LoadArea-400x244.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200LoadArea-600x365.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200LoadArea-800x487.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200LoadArea.jpg 1089w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-63 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>With one wheelbase and one roof height the dimension of the cargo area are pretty simple, starting with the internal width which is 1500mm and this reduces to 1220mm between the wheel arches but this still allows a metric or euro pallet to fit lengths – just be careful of any plying lining etc. The maximum available load length is 2800mm if the optional folding mesh partition wall is included and the interior height is 1360mm with the rear load height is 524mm. This results in an overall cargo area capacity of 4.2 cubic metres.</p>
<h2>Nissan e-NV200 Cargo Doors</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-35 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1087" height="618" title="eNV200RearLoading"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200RearLoading.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-5826"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200RearLoading-200x114.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200RearLoading-400x227.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200RearLoading-600x341.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200RearLoading-800x455.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/eNV200RearLoading.jpg 1087w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-64 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>A side load door is standard on the e-NV200 and it measures 700mm at its widest section and is 1171mm high, the rear cargo doors width match virtually the width between the wheel arches at 1262mm and they are 1228 high.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-14 fusion-flex-container hund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="width:104% !important;max-width:104% !important;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-22 fusion_builder_column_1_1 1_1 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:100%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:2.56%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:1.92%;--awb-width-medium:100%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:2.56%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:1.92%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-title title fusion-title-17 fusion-sep-none fusion-title-text fusion-title-size-one" style="--awb-margin-top-small:10px;--awb-margin-right-small:0px;--awb-margin-bottom-small:10px;--awb-margin-left-small:0px;"><h1 class="fusion-title-heading title-heading-left fusion-responsive-typography-calculated" style="margin:0;--fontSize:40;line-height:1.2;">Nissan</h1></div></div></div></div></div><div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-15 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-23 fusion_builder_column_2_3 2_3 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:66.666666666667%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:3.84%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:2.88%;--awb-width-medium:66.666666666667%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:3.84%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:2.88%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-37 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="800" height="445" title="NissanNv300-800&#215;445"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NissanNv300-800x445-1.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-5716"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NissanNv300-800x445-1-200x111.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NissanNv300-800x445-1-400x223.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NissanNv300-800x445-1-600x334.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NissanNv300-800x445-1.jpg 800w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-66 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>In this article we are going to look at the Nissan NV300 dimensions which is the medium van offering in their commercial vehicle range and we will outline the key measurements such as the interior and exterior dimensions as well as the door apertures.</p>
<h2>Exterior Dimensions</h2>
<p>There are basically four variants of the NV300 and this is made up of two wheelbases and two roof heights, in the first instance we will look at the short wheelbase (L1) with the low (H1) and high (H2) roofs. The short wheelbase (3098mm) is 4999mm long and 1956mm wide without the mirrors or 2283mm including the mirror. The exterior height on the H1 is 1971mm and 2493mm on the higher roof.</p>
<p>The width and roof height dimensions stay the same for the L2 wheelbase is 400mm extra on the wheelbase and overall length at 3498mm and 5399mm respectively.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-38 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="791" height="239" title="NV300ExteriorDims"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300ExteriorDims.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-5717"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300ExteriorDims-200x60.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300ExteriorDims-400x121.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300ExteriorDims-600x181.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300ExteriorDims.jpg 791w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 791px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-67 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Cargo Area – Short wheelbase</h2>
<p>The short wheelbase has a internal load length of 2537mm, which may be extended to 2967mm with the flex cargo system and can be further extended by lifting up the front passenger seats to 3750mm. Of course the front bulkhead does intrude into the cargo area higher up, and at one metre the load length reduces to 2250mm.</p>
<p>The maximum internal width is 1662mm but between the wheel arches this reduces to 1268mm, but this still allows for a euro and metric pallet to fit between them. The internal height on the H1 is 1387mm and 1898mm on the H2, this results in a total load volume of 5.2 cubic metres on the L1H1 and 7.2 cubic metres on the L1H2.</p>
<h2>Cargo Area – Long wheelbase</h2>
<p>The long wheelbase has a internal load length of 2937mm, which may be extended to 3350mm with the flex cargo system and can be further extended by lifting up the front passenger seats to 4150mm. Of course the front bulkhead does intrude into the cargo area higher up, and at one metre the load length reduces to 2650mm.</p>
<p>The maximum internal width and height doesn’t change from the short wheelbase and this results in a total load volume of 6 cubic metres on the L2H1 and 8.6 cubic metres on the L2H2.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-39 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1061" height="613" title="NV300RearDoors" src="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300RearDoors.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-5718"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300RearDoors-200x116.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300RearDoors-400x231.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300RearDoors-600x347.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300RearDoors-800x462.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/07/NV300RearDoors.jpg 1061w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-68 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Nissan NV300 Door Dimensions</h2>
<p>The side load door are the same dimensions on both wheelbase and have a maximum width of 1030 although this reduces to 907mm at its narrowest section, the height is 1284mm.</p>
<p>The rear doors are 1391mm wide measured 70mm from the floor and the H1 doors are 1320mm high and 500mm higher on the H2.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-16 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-25 fusion_builder_column_1_1 1_1 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:100%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:2.56%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:1.92%;--awb-width-medium:100%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:2.56%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:1.92%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"></div></div></div></div><div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-17 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-26 fusion_builder_column_2_3 2_3 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:66.666666666667%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:3.84%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:2.88%;--awb-width-medium:66.666666666667%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:3.84%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:2.88%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-title title fusion-title-19 fusion-sep-none fusion-title-text fusion-title-size-two" style="--awb-text-color:var(--awb-color2);--awb-margin-top:0px;--awb-margin-bottom:5px;--awb-margin-top-small:10px;--awb-margin-right-small:0px;--awb-margin-bottom-small:10px;--awb-margin-left-small:0px;--awb-font-size:20px;"><h2 class="fusion-title-heading title-heading-left fusion-responsive-typography-calculated" style="font-family:&quot;DM Sans&quot;;font-style:normal;font-weight:400;margin:0;letter-spacing:var(--awb-typography2-letter-spacing);font-size:1em;--fontSize:20;--minFontSize:20;line-height:1.4;"><h1 class="entry-title">Nissan Townstar van makes debut</h1></h2></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-70 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>There have been many rumours about the long awaited replacement for Nissan’s compact light commercial vehicle (LCV) the NV200 and finally they have announced the launch of the all new Townstar. As with most new models, the all-new Nissan Townstar brings together a blend of new technologies matched to state of the art styling and the option of an electric powertrain.</p>
<h2>Nissan Townstar Drivetrain</h2>
<p>Perhaps one of the most interesting aspects of the driveline is the absence of a diesel version, probably a first for a new van in the UK market for decades! There are two drivelines a 1.3-litre petrol engine fully Euro 6d compliant producing 130HP and 240Nm of torque. But the full electric version is the one that’s ultimately going to be the most popular and features a 44kWh battery delivering 245Nm of torque and 177 miles of range (pending homologation) – a 43% improvement over the outgoing e-NV200.</p>
<h2>Nissan Townstar Safety</h2>
<p>Nissan is integrating the Around View Monitor (AVM) for the first time in the compact van segment which uses a suite of cameras, the system displays a 360-degree overview of the area around the vehicle. It also features</p>
<ul>
<li>Side Wind Assist</li>
<li>and Trailer Sway Assist</li>
<li>Intelligent Emergency Braking featuring Pedestrian and Cyclist Detection and Junction Assist,</li>
<li>Hands-Free Parking</li>
<li>Intelligent Cruise Control</li>
</ul>
<p>The fully electric all-new Townstar will Have Nissan’s ProPILOT advanced driver assistance system which allows the vehicle to automatically slow to a full stop and accelerate by following the vehicle ahead, as well as keeping it centred in the lane – even around a gentle curve.</p>
<p>The connected services will be presented via an 8-inch touchscreen linked to a 10-inch digital combimeter in front of the driver and features E-Call, Apple CarPlay/Android Auto, and wireless phone charging will be available across the range from launch, with further enhanced Connected Services available from the launch of the fully electric version.</p>
<h2>Nissan Townstar Interior / Exterior</h2>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:25px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-42 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="683" title="Townstarpetrolvandetail02-1024&#215;683" src="/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ail02-1024x683-1.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-3271"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ail02-1024x683-1-200x133.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ail02-1024x683-1-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ail02-1024x683-1-600x400.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ail02-1024x683-1-800x534.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ail02-1024x683-1.jpg 1024w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-71 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>The new Townstar is built on the Alliance CMF-C platform and is the first European model to be produced Nissan Logo and is part of their wider ‘Nissan NEXT’ transformation plan which prioritizes sustainable growth and profitability across the company’s global operations.</p>
<p>There are newly designed seats and door trims to a modern centre console and instrument panel finish and takes its aesthetic cues from the Ariya, including signature standard LED headlamps and an aerodynamic front windscreen with V-motion design with daytime running lamps.</p>
<h2>Townstar Cargo area</h2>
<p>The cargo area is very similar to the out going NV200 / eNV200 and has a 4.3m<sup>3</sup> of cargo space and can accommodate a two Euro pallets and up to 800kg of payload together with a 1,500kg towing capacity. The cargo area integrates large sliding doors on the side which facilitate unloading the van and the possibility to have 60/40 French doors with 180 degree opening at the rear. It also includes smart storage solutions and a dedicated space for on-board office tools.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:25px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-43 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="684" title="Townstarpetrolvandetail11-1024&#215;684" src="/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ail11-1024x684-1.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-3272"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ail11-1024x684-1-200x134.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ail11-1024x684-1-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ail11-1024x684-1-600x401.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ail11-1024x684-1-800x534.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/Townstarpetrolvandetail11-1024x684-1.jpg 1024w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-72 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Nissan Warranty<strong>                               </strong></h2>
<p>As with all Nissan’s in their LCV range the Townstar comes with pan-European 5-Year or 100,000-mile warranty, in addition to the eight-year or 100,000-mile battery warranty for the EV version. This includes bumper-to-bumper protection, paintwork guarantee, genuine parts and accessories and roadside assistance – providing comprehensive cover for extra peace of mind.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-18 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-28 fusion_builder_column_1_1 1_1 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:100%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:2.56%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:1.92%;--awb-width-medium:100%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:2.56%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:1.92%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"></div></div></div></div><div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-19 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-29 fusion_builder_column_2_3 2_3 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:66.666666666667%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:3.84%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:2.88%;--awb-width-medium:66.666666666667%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:3.84%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:2.88%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-title title fusion-title-20 fusion-sep-none fusion-title-text fusion-title-size-two" style="--awb-text-color:var(--awb-color2);--awb-margin-top:0px;--awb-margin-bottom:5px;--awb-margin-top-small:10px;--awb-margin-right-small:0px;--awb-margin-bottom-small:10px;--awb-margin-left-small:0px;--awb-font-size:20px;"><h2 class="fusion-title-heading title-heading-left fusion-responsive-typography-calculated" style="font-family:&quot;DM Sans&quot;;font-style:normal;font-weight:400;margin:0;letter-spacing:var(--awb-typography2-letter-spacing);font-size:1em;--fontSize:20;--minFontSize:20;line-height:1.4;"><h1 class="entry-title">Nissan Upgrades the NV300 Combi</h1></h2></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-73 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p><strong>Nissan Upgrades the NV300 Combi with a new Euro 6D compliant powertrain, a redefined exterior appearance and an interior featuring more storage and a number of advanced driver systems.</strong></p>
<h2>Nissan NV300 Driveline</h2>
<p>The new NV300 is powered by their 2.0-litre dCi which is Euro 6 D compliant and has three power ratings starting at 110hp with a manual gearbox only, 150hp with a manual and automatic gearbox, finally a 170hp with the automatic gearbox only. The new engine features a variable-geometry turbocharger (VGT) which achieves greater power from 110 to 170hp and an increased torque up to 380 Nm.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-45 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="683" title="NewNV300CombiDynamic5-1024&#215;683" src="/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ic5-1024x683-1.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-3094"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ic5-1024x683-1-200x133.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ic5-1024x683-1-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ic5-1024x683-1-600x400.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ic5-1024x683-1-800x534.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ic5-1024x683-1.jpg 1024w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-74 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Nissan NV300 Exterior</h2>
<p>On the exterior, the new NV300 has a bolder and more enhanced interlock front grille and bumper design, similar to the other Nissan light commercial vehicle line-up. The front also features new LED headlamps and a Nissan specific daytime running lamp signature. Its also has 17-inch alloy wheels which are available on certain grades.</p>
<h2>Nissan NV300 Combi Interior</h2>
<p>Inside the NV300 cabin has been completely refreshed with 9 seats for maximum utility thanks to a passenger bench seat complete with under-seat storage dependent on version. There’s also an all-new dashboard with satin chrome buttons and a dark carbon colour scheme and storage has been increased by 88 litres, 54 litres provided by the under-passenger seat storage.</p>
<p>Dmitry Busurkin, Corporate Sales &amp; LCV General Manager for Nissan Europe, said: “The NV300 was already a versatile Combi for big families and professionals in passenger transport. The new Nissan NV300 is a smart and comfortable people mover, with the upgraded mid-sized van offering more space and convenience to customers.</p>
</div><div class="fusion-image-element" style="--awb-margin-bottom:15px;--awb-max-width:100%;--awb-caption-title-font-family:var(--h2_typography-font-family);--awb-caption-title-font-weight:var(--h2_typography-font-weight);--awb-caption-title-font-style:var(--h2_typography-font-style);--awb-caption-title-size:var(--h2_typography-font-size);--awb-caption-title-transform:var(--h2_typography-text-transform);--awb-caption-title-line-height:var(--h2_typography-line-height);--awb-caption-title-letter-spacing:var(--h2_typography-letter-spacing);"><span class=" fusion-imageframe imageframe-none imageframe-46 hover-type-none"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="683" title="NewNV300CombiDynamic12-1024&#215;683" src="/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ic12-1024x683-1.jpg" alt class="img-responsive wp-image-3096" srcset="https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ic12-1024x683-1-200x133.jpg 200w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ic12-1024x683-1-400x267.jpg 400w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ic12-1024x683-1-600x400.jpg 600w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ic12-1024x683-1-800x534.jpg 800w, https://www.vanguide.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2022/06/NewNV300CombiDynamic12-1024x683-1.jpg 1024w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 800px" /></span></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-75 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><h2>Nissan NV300 Combi Safety</h2>
<p>As with most upgraded models recently the NV300 has a number of advanced driving assistance systems (ADAS) including safety features such as Blind Spot Warning, Lane Departure Warning, Traffic Sign Recognition, dependent on which model you chose. There are also two new improved passenger front airbags.</p>
<p>Model dependent it also has a multi-touch 8-inch NissanConnect infotainment system which provides drivers and passengers with infotainment and navigation and seamless connection via smartphone (Android Auto and Apple CarPlay).</p>
<h2>NV300 Combi Warranty and Price</h2>
<p>The new NV300 Combi is backed by a five year / 100,000 mile pan-European warranty and the vehicle will be on sale across the UK from May 2021 with prices announced around that time.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-20 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-31 fusion_builder_column_1_1 1_1 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:100%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:2.56%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:1.92%;--awb-width-medium:100%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:2.56%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:1.92%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"></div></div></div></div><div class="fusion-fullwidth fullwidth-box fusion-builder-row-21 fusion-flex-container nonhundred-percent-fullwidth non-hundred-percent-height-scrolling" style="--awb-border-radius-top-left:0px;--awb-border-radius-top-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-right:0px;--awb-border-radius-bottom-left:0px;--awb-padding-right:0px;--awb-padding-left:0px;--awb-flex-wrap:wrap;" ><div class="fusion-builder-row fusion-row fusion-flex-align-items-flex-start fusion-flex-content-wrap" style="max-width:1248px;margin-left: calc(-4% / 2 );margin-right: calc(-4% / 2 );"><div class="fusion-layout-column fusion_builder_column fusion-builder-column-32 fusion_builder_column_2_3 2_3 fusion-flex-column" style="--awb-bg-size:cover;--awb-width-large:66.666666666667%;--awb-margin-top-large:0px;--awb-spacing-right-large:3.84%;--awb-margin-bottom-large:0px;--awb-spacing-left-large:2.88%;--awb-width-medium:66.666666666667%;--awb-spacing-right-medium:3.84%;--awb-spacing-left-medium:2.88%;--awb-width-small:100%;--awb-spacing-right-small:1.92%;--awb-spacing-left-small:1.92%;"><div class="fusion-column-wrapper fusion-flex-justify-content-flex-start fusion-content-layout-column"><div class="fusion-title title fusion-title-21 fusion-sep-none fusion-title-text fusion-title-size-two" style="--awb-text-color:var(--awb-color2);--awb-margin-top:0px;--awb-margin-bottom:5px;--awb-margin-top-small:10px;--awb-margin-right-small:0px;--awb-margin-bottom-small:10px;--awb-margin-left-small:0px;--awb-font-size:20px;"><h2 class="fusion-title-heading title-heading-left fusion-responsive-typography-calculated" style="font-family:&quot;DM Sans&quot;;font-style:normal;font-weight:400;margin:0;letter-spacing:var(--awb-typography2-letter-spacing);font-size:1em;--fontSize:20;--minFontSize:20;line-height:1.4;"><h1 class="entry-title">New Nissan NV250 to be produced in France</h1></h2></div><div class="fusion-text fusion-text-76 fusion-text-no-margin" style="--awb-content-alignment:justify;--awb-margin-bottom:20px;"><p>Nissan’s light commercial vehicle division have been going through interesting time recently, particularly with announcement last year regarding the closing of the Barcelona plant which has been producing the NV200 and more importantly the very successful electric version, the e-NV200.</p>
<p>So we have been waiting for what the next step would be regarding the next generation of small vans for the European market.</p>
<h2>Maubeuge factory to be used</h2>
<p>It comes as no great shock to the automotive industry that Nissan have announced they will continue to leverage their Alliance partnership with Renault by manufacturing their next small van at the Maubeuge factory in France, the Alliance’s small van centre of excellence.</p>
<p>Nissan are been very vague about the exact specification, keeping this information for closer to the launch date, but they have disclosed the range will include all-electric and internal combustion engine options, as well as commercial and passenger vehicle variants, with various size combinations.</p>
<p>Nissan’s Chief Operating Officer Ashwani Gupta said: “This future van announcement is more evidence of the strong momentum building for Nissan in Europe as we continue to advance our Nissan NEXT business transformation plan. Manufacturing our future products together with our Alliance partner brings competitive advantages for both companies and is another example of our win-win strategy. While it is too early to give any detailed product information, our customers can be sure they will have a strong Nissan identity and continue our mission of making the all-electric driving experience a viable option for everyone.”</p>
<p>This means, after the closing of the Barcelona plant in Spain, all of Nissan’s vans for European customers will be manufactured in France.</p>
<p>Like the current Nissan NV250 van, which has been manufactured at the Renault Maubeuge plant since 2019, the next-generation model will be built on an Alliance platform alongside the next-generation Renault Kangoo.</p>
